Hiring in the UK has been challenging for quite some time, but talent scarcity is especially pronounced in difficult-to-fill positions. While hard-to-fill positions may constitute a minor portion of the total job openings in a company, they can have a significant impact on operations.

According to the Time to Hire Factbook, within all industries, there is a growing disparity between roles considered "easy to fill" and those categorised as "difficult to fill." While some positions can be filled within 14 days, many remain unfilled for around two months. In the UK, 42% of employers grapple with hard-to-fill job vacancies. This underscores the importance of adopting a refined hiring strategy, particularly for challenging-to-fill roles and developing innovative approaches to expedite the recruitment process for these positions.

Identifying and Tackling Problem Roles- Your Checklist

Recognising and categorising difficult-to-fill positions is crucial for optimising your recruitment strategies. Here's a handy checklist to help you get started.

Define and Identify Problem Roles:

Establish clear criteria for problematic roles, define the requisite skill sets, and identify the sectors where these challenging positions are prevalent. This approach helps streamline the recruitment process and improve overall hiring efficiency.

Changes in Approach:

Acknowledge that challenging positions require customised solutions. Consider diversifying your candidate pool for effective talent attraction from a wide range of age groups, including younger individuals, individuals from diverse talent pools, and those over 50.

Go Social:

As of January 2023, there were 57.1 million active social media users in the United Kingdom (UK). This data underscores the significance of establishing a solid social media hiring plan, enhancing your prospects of attracting talent, and engaging with skilled candidates, especially for challenging-to-fill positions.

Make Application Easier:

The high demand for skilled candidates adds more difficulty to already challenging-to-fill positions. To address this, it's essential to streamline the application process and offer an exceptional candidate experience. This increases the likelihood of attracting these candidates to your organisation.

Know Your Recruitment Funnel:

Examine the recruitment funnel closely to extract valuable insights about the hiring process. Identify the origins of successful hires and spot the stages where candidates tend to abandon their applications. By doing so, you can pinpoint the most efficient recruitment channels. Implement data-driven talent acquisition practices to gain insights so that you can optimise your approach to filling challenging positions for better outcomes.
